You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@servicemix.apache.org by gn...@apache.org on 2007/04/06 10:19:50 UTC

svn commit: r526090 - /inc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java

Author: gnodet
Date: Fri Apr  6 01:19:49 2007
New Revision: 526090

URL: http://svn.apache.org/viewvc?view=rev&rev=526090
Log:
SM-922: When browsing for available services, existing urls should end with a '/' when displayed

Modified:
    inc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java

Modified: inc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java
URL: http://svn.apache.org/viewvc/inc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java?view=diff&rev=526090&r1=526089&r2=526090
==============================================================================
--- inc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java (original)
+++ incubator/servicemix/branches/servicemix-3.1/deployables/bindingcomponents/servicemix-http/src/main/java/org/apache/servicemix/http/jetty/JettyContextManager.java Fri Apr  6 01:19:49 2007
@@ -397,24 +397,24 @@
                         continue;
                     }
                     ContextHandler context = (ContextHandler) handlers[i];
+                    StringBuffer sb = new StringBuffer();
+                    sb.append(serverUri);
+                    if (!context.getContextPath().startsWith("/")) {
+                        sb.append("/");
+                    }
+                    sb.append(context.getContextPath());
+                    if (!context.getContextPath().endsWith("/")) {
+                        sb.append("/");
+                    }
                     if (context.isStarted()) {
                         writer.write("<li><a href=\"");
-                        writer.write(serverUri);
-                        if (!context.getContextPath().startsWith("/")) {
-                            writer.write("/");
-                        }
-                        writer.write(context.getContextPath());
-                        if (!context.getContextPath().endsWith("/")) {
-                            writer.write("/");
-                        }
+                        writer.write(sb.toString());
                         writer.write("?wsdl\">");
-                        writer.write(serverUri);
-                        writer.write(context.getContextPath());
+                        writer.write(sb.toString());
                         writer.write("</a></li>\n");
                     } else {
                         writer.write("<li>");
-                        writer.write(serverUri);
-                        writer.write(context.getContextPath());
+                        writer.write(sb.toString());
                         writer.write(" [Stopped]</li>\n");
                     }
                 }